Output ec45d5a6df8e83e604eb23391b8526f480506f7c973e00ffeae4d25cb4aa2835:1

value
100144544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73d5786be008a021d65be2c5db1b4b60fba6f098 OP_EQUAL
address
3CFVMnd3qaWXMZT568FydHqzbeT9KfXPWX
transaction
ec45d5a6df8e83e604eb23391b8526f480506f7c973e00ffeae4d25cb4aa2835
spent
true